It’s important to note that not all vegetables are safe for birds to consume. Offering your bird a variety of safe vegetables is an important part of maintaining their health and wellbeing. Bright yellow, red, and orange vegetables and fruits, including bell peppers, broccoli, carrots, sweet potatoes, squash, mango, papaya, and cantaloupe, all contain a great deal of vitamin. Focus on yellow and orange vegetables rich in beta carotene (vitamin a), and dark green leafy vegetables which are packed with b vitamins, calcium, antioxidants, and minerals. The healthiest fruits and veggies have the deepest colors.
